#b44208 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b44208 is composed of 70.6% red, 25.9% green and 3.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 63.3% magenta, 95.6% yellow and 29.4% black. It has a hue angle of 20.2 degrees, a saturation of 91.5% and a lightness of 36.9%. #b44208 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ff8410 with #690000. Closest websafe color is: #cc3300.

Shades and Tints of #b44208
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b0400 is the darkest color, while #fffaf7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#b44208
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#645c58 is the less saturated color, while #bb4001 is the most saturated one.
